@charset "UTF-8";.entry-cooking{overflow:hidden;padding:0 0 60px}.cookinglesson p{line-height:1.8;margin-top:0;margin-bottom:1.6em;font-size:1rem}.cookinglesson a{color:#002c72;text-decoration:underline}.cookinglesson h1{margin-bottom:.5em;line-height:1.4;font-size:2em;font-weight:500}@media (max-width:834px){.cookinglesson h1{font-size:1.7em}}.cookinglesson h2,.cookinglesson h3,.cookinglesson h4,.cookinglesson h5,.cookinglesson h6{font-weight:500;margin-top:2.5em;margin-bottom:1em;line-height:1.4}.cookinglesson h2{font-size:1.75em}@media (max-width:834px){.cookinglesson h2{font-size:1.5em}}.cookinglesson h3{font-size:1.3em}.cookinglesson h4{font-size:1.1em;background-color:#f1f1f1;padding:8px 15px}.cookinglesson h5{font-size:1em;padding-left:1.2em;position:relative}.cookinglesson h5:before{content:"";position:absolute;left:0;top:50%;transform:translateY(-50%);width:.75em;height:.75em;background-color:#333}.cookinglesson h6{font-size:.9em}.cookinglesson ul,.cookinglesson ol{padding-left:1.5em;margin-top:0;margin-bottom:1.6em}.cookinglesson ul li::marker,.cookinglesson ol li::marker{color:#444}.cookinglesson ul li,.cookinglesson ol li{list-style-type:disc}.cookinglesson ol li::marker{color:#888}.cookinglesson table{width:100%;border-collapse:collapse;font-size:.95rem}.cookinglesson table th,.cookinglesson table td{border:1px solid #ccc;padding:.75em;text-align:left}.cookinglesson table th{background:#f5f5f5;font-weight:700}@media (max-width:834px){.cookinglesson .wp-block-table.sp-scroll{width:100%;display:block;overflow-x:scroll}}@media (max-width:834px){.cookinglesson .wp-block-table.sp-scroll table{width:480px}}.cookinglesson .wp-block-table.sp-scroll table .month{white-space:nowrap}@media (max-width:834px){.cookinglesson .wp-block-table.sp-scroll table td{max-width:220px}}.cookinglesson .wp-block-button{margin:2em 0;text-align:left}@media (max-width:834px){.cookinglesson .wp-block-button{margin:1em 0}}.cookinglesson .wp-block-button.aligncenter{text-align:center}.cookinglesson .wp-block-button.alignright{text-align:right}.cookinglesson .wp-block-button.gray .wp-block-button__link{background-color:#ababab;border:1px solid #ababab;color:#fff}.cookinglesson .wp-block-button.gray .wp-block-button__link:after{border-top:solid 1px #fff;border-right:solid 1px #fff}.cookinglesson .wp-block-button.gray .wp-block-button__link:hover{color:#fff;background-color:#ababab;text-decoration:none}.cookinglesson .wp-block-button.gray .wp-block-button__link:hover:after{border-top:solid 1px #fff;border-right:solid 1px #fff}.cookinglesson .wp-block-button__link{font-size:12px;padding:16px 40px;position:relative;display:inline-block;text-align:center;background-color:#002c72;border:1px solid #002c72;color:#fff;transition:all .4s;border-radius:50px;text-decoration:none}.cookinglesson .wp-block-button__link strong{font-size:1.2em}.cookinglesson .wp-block-button__link:after{display:block;content:"";position:absolute;top:50%;right:20px;width:4px;height:4px;margin-top:-2px;border-top:1px solid #fff;border-right:1px solid #fff;transform:rotate(45deg);transition:all .4s}.cookinglesson .wp-block-button__link:hover{color:#002c72;background-color:#fff;text-decoration:none}.cookinglesson .wp-block-button__link:hover:after{border-top:1px solid #002c72;border-right:1px solid #002c72}.cookinglesson .wp-block-buttons.is-content-justification-center{justify-content:center;display:flex;flex-wrap:wrap;gap:.5em}.cookinglesson .wp-block-buttons.is-content-justification-left{justify-content:flex-start}.cookinglesson .wp-block-buttons.is-content-justification-right{justify-content:flex-end}.cookinglesson .wp-block-buttons.is-content-justification-space-between{justify-content:space-between}.cookinglesson .wp-block-buttons.is-content-justification-space-around{justify-content:space-around}.cookinglesson .wp-block-buttons.is-content-justification-space-evenly{justify-content:space-evenly}.cookinglesson .wp-block-columns{display:flex;flex-wrap:wrap;margin:2em 0}.cookinglesson .wp-block-columns .wp-block-column{flex:1;min-width:200px}.cookinglesson blockquote{border-left:4px solid #ccc;padding-left:1em;color:#555;font-style:italic;margin:2em 0}.cookinglesson .wp-block-image{margin:2em 0}.cookinglesson .wp-block-image.aligncenter{display:flex;justify-content:center}.cookinglesson .wp-block-image.alignright{display:flex;justify-content:flex-end}.cookinglesson .wp-block-image.alignleft{display:flex;justify-content:flex-start}.cookinglesson .wp-block-image img{max-width:100%;height:auto;display:block}.cookinglesson .wp-block-gallery{display:flex;flex-wrap:wrap;gap:1rem;margin:0;padding:0}.cookinglesson .wp-block-gallery.columns-2 .wp-block-image{width:calc(50% - 0.5rem)}.cookinglesson .wp-block-gallery.columns-3 .wp-block-image{width:calc(33.333% - 0.66rem)}.cookinglesson .wp-block-gallery .wp-block-image{margin:0}.cookinglesson .wp-block-gallery .wp-block-image img{width:100%;height:auto;display:block;-o-object-fit:cover;object-fit:cover;border-radius:4px}.cookinglesson .wp-block-gallery.is-cropped .wp-block-image img{aspect-ratio:4/3;height:auto;-o-object-fit:cover;object-fit:cover}.cookinglesson .wp-block-gallery{display:flex;flex-wrap:wrap;gap:1rem;margin:0;padding:0}.cookinglesson .wp-block-gallery.columns-2>.wp-block-image{width:calc(50% - 0.5rem)}.cookinglesson .wp-block-gallery .wp-block-image{position:relative;margin:0;overflow:hidden}.cookinglesson .wp-block-gallery .wp-block-image img{width:100%;height:auto;display:block;-o-object-fit:cover;object-fit:cover}.cookinglesson .wp-block-gallery.is-cropped .wp-block-image img{aspect-ratio:3/2;-o-object-fit:cover;object-fit:cover;height:auto}.cookinglesson .wp-block-gallery .wp-block-image figcaption{position:absolute;bottom:0;left:0;width:100%;padding:.75em 1em;background:linear-gradient(to top,rgba(0,0,0,.4),transparent 60%);color:#fff;font-size:.8rem;text-align:center;line-height:1.5;text-shadow:0 1px 2px rgba(0,0,0,.5);box-sizing:border-box;font-weight:400}.cookinglesson small,.cookinglesson .small-text{font-size:.8em;color:#666}.cookinglesson .text-red{color:#d60000}.cookinglesson .text-blue{color:#005bac}.cookinglesson .text-gray{color:#666}.cookinglesson .has-text-align-left{text-align:left}.cookinglesson .has-text-align-center{text-align:center}.cookinglesson .has-text-align-right{text-align:right}.cookinglesson .alignleft{text-align:left}.cookinglesson .aligncenter{text-align:center}.cookinglesson .alignright{text-align:right}.cookinglesson .entry-info{padding:0}.cookinglesson .mt-0{margin-top:0 !important}.faq h2,.faq h3,.faq h4,.faq h5,.faq h6{font-weight:500;margin-top:2.5em;margin-bottom:1em;line-height:1.4}.faq h2{font-size:1.2em;background-color:#f1f1f1;margin-top:1.5em;margin-bottom:1em;padding:12px}@media (max-width:834px){.faq h2{font-size:1.1em}}.faq h3{font-size:1em}.faq h4{font-size:1em;background-color:#f1f1f1;padding:8px 15px}.faq p{font-size:.95em}.faq .stk-block-heading h3{padding-left:20px;position:relative}.faq .stk-block-heading h3:before{content:"Q";position:absolute;left:0;top:0}@media (max-width:834px){.faq .page-link{margin:0 auto .5em}}.faq .page-link .wp-block-button__link:after{transform:rotate(135deg)}@media (max-width:834px){.faq .other-link{margin:0 auto .5em}}@media (max-width:834px){.faq .stk-block-icon-label .stk-inner-blocks{gap:0px}}